If you've decided on a fixed page design, you should know these few tricks to get around the cons of this layout and create a successful design.

All this being said, most designers choose a fixed width of 960 pixels.
A layout 960 pixels wide looks good for users with a 1024×768 resolution or above, with a bit of room for margins.

Always Center the Layout

When working with a fixed width design, be sure to at least center the wrapper div to maintain a sense of balance. Otherwise, for users with large screen resolutions, the entire layout will be tucked away in the corner.

Choosing between a fixed and fluid website will depend a lot on the type of website itself. Weigh the pros and cons above to determine the right solution for your website.

A portfolio website would probably be best shown in a fixed-width layout, so that you have more control over the design. Not only will you be able to better control the layout of individual elements in the design, but the images in your portfolio showcase will be better handled with a fixed width. Many designers, not just those with portfolios, may prefer fixed-width layouts for the ease of use and assurance it gives them.
